Comprehending Bifold Doors
Bifold doors are made up of several panels that fold in on themselves, using a distinct method to open a room to the outside or reconfigure interior spaces. Generally made from wood, fiberglass, or aluminum, their appearance frequently decreases due to use and tear, direct exposure to the components, and basic use.

The Refinishing Process
Refinishing bifold doors generally involves numerous actions. Let's break down the procedure for a clearer understanding:
Step-by-Step Refinishing Procedure
Preparation: Remove the doors from their hinges and lay them flat on a work surface area. Clean the surface area completely to remove dirt and grease.

Sanding: Use sandpaper (usually an orbital sander) to remove away the old surface. Start with coarse grit and slowly move to finer grit for a smooth surface area.

Repair: Inspect for any structural damage, such as cracks or chips. Use wood filler to repair damaged locations and sand down when it dries.

Staining/Painting: Apply a stain or paint of your option with a brush or roller. Make sure to operate in even strokes and enable for drying time in between coats.

Sealing: Once the stain or paint has actually dried, apply a clear sealant surface to secure the door from moisture and wear. This action is important for toughness.

Reinstallation: After the doors are completely dry, reattach them to the frame and check for proper functionality.

How typically should I refinish my bifold doors?
It depends upon the product and ecological exposure but typically every 3 to 5 years is an excellent guideline.
2. Can I refinish bifold doors in location?
While it's possible, it's recommended to get rid of the doors for a more thorough task and easier access to all surface areas.
3. What kind of finish is best for bifold doors?
The finest surface depends upon your choice. For wood doors, staining with a clear sealant is popular. For painted finishes, a latex or acrylic paint is ideal.
4. Can I alter the color of my bifold doors throughout refinishing?
Absolutely! This is one of the main factors for refinishing. Simply remember to select a color that complements your general home style.
